Why do people with addictions have a choice of treatment?

I watch Intervention on TV, and it amazes me that people with drug and alcohol problems are given the choice to go to rehab…..Obviously these people are not in their right mind…..so why do they get the choice? I am not saying food addictions or smoking should lead to your rights being taken away, but drugs and alcohol alter a persons mind to the point where I believe they can not be considered competent to make choices.

Because a person needs to want the help. Also the beds that are available don’t meet the demand. Programs want to take those that want to be there to be successful rather than give a bed away to a person who is coerced, and likely to break rules, and wreak havoc by sneaking in contraband, and its negative to those who want the help that are there. You need to change people places and things.

In my state, DE there are 200 beds for drug/alcohol, the need for beds is 4000.
